Former Labour Party presidential candidate, Peter Obi, has emphasised the importance of women’s rights, equality, and empowerment for the advancement of Nigeria. Commemorating this year’s International Women’s Day celebration in a statement on Saturday, Obi urged the government to ensure a minimum of 25% representation in governance and aggressive investment in the girl-child education.
